Employment Arrangements in Ontario
Ontario's employment landscape is governed by a comprehensive framework of laws and regulations. When entering into an employment arrangement, it's crucial to understand the legal obligations and rights that apply. While verbal agreements can exist, a written contract provides greater transparency and protection for both parties.
Ontario law dictates certain mandatory elements that must be included in written contracts. These typically include the parties involved, the nature of the job, the remuneration structure, and the duration of the agreement.
Additionally, Ontario's employment standards legislation outlines minimum guidelines regarding things like time spent at work, vacation time, insurance options, and termination procedures.
